Owley Wood Recreation Club
19 Barrymore Rd, Weaverham, Northwich CW8 3LS, UK
Contact Information
19 Barrymore Rd, Weaverham, Northwich CW8 3LS, UK
Manage Your Venue Better
Streamline bookings, coordinate events, and manage your team with Crescat's venue management tools.
Learn more